What Is Lipofilling?
Lipofilling is a cosmetic procedure in which fat is taken from one part of the body and re-injected into another to add volume, smooth lines, or improve contours. Common donor areas include the abdomen, thighs, or flanks, where small amounts of fat can be harvested through gentle liposuction. Once purified, the fat cells are carefully injected into areas where volume is desired, such as:
- Face – to soften wrinkles, restore youthful fullness to cheeks, or correct hollow under-eyes.
- Breasts – to enhance size naturally or improve shape after implants or reconstruction.
- Buttocks – to achieve a rounder, lifted look without implants.
- Hands – to smooth and rejuvenate the appearance of ageing hands.
Because lipofilling uses your own tissue, it is considered a biocompatible and safe method for natural enhancement.
How Does Lipofilling Work?
The procedure generally follows three main steps:
- Fat Harvesting – Fat is gently removed via liposuction from a donor site.
- Purification – The extracted fat is processed to separate healthy fat cells from fluids or damaged tissue.
- Fat Injection – The purified fat is injected into the treatment area in small, precise amounts to create natural contours.
The results depend on how much of the transferred fat “takes” in the new area, but with modern techniques, most patients experience long-lasting improvement after just one session.

How Long Does Lipofilling Last?
One of the most common questions about lipofilling is how long the results last. Initially, not all transferred fat cells will survive; typically, 50–70% of the fat remains in place permanently. The surviving fat integrates with the surrounding tissue, meaning results can last many years. In some cases, patients may opt for a second session to achieve their desired volume. Compared with dermal fillers, which dissolve over time, lipofilling often provides more durable results.
Is Lipofilling Safe?
Lipofilling is widely regarded as a safe procedure when performed by an experienced plastic surgeon. Because it avoids synthetic materials, risks of allergic reaction or implant-related complications are eliminated. However, like any surgical procedure, there are potential risks such as swelling, bruising, or uneven results. Choosing a qualified specialist is key to achieving natural, balanced outcomes.
Who Is a Good Candidate for Lipofilling?
You may be a suitable candidate for lipofilling if you:
- Have areas with unwanted fat that can be harvested.
- Want natural-looking volume restoration rather than synthetic fillers or implants.
- Are in good overall health with realistic expectations.
- Seek long-lasting results in areas such as the face, breasts, or buttocks.
Patients who are very slim with little available fat may not be ideal candidates, but your surgeon can recommend the best approach for your individual goals.

Recovery and Downtime
Recovery from lipofilling is generally straightforward. Most patients experience swelling or bruising in both donor and treated areas for a few days to weeks. Light activities can usually be resumed within a few days, while full recovery takes several weeks. Because the fat needs time to settle and integrate, final results are typically visible after two to three months.
